I personally have experience OKAY and Adventure Line aluminum mags. I shot them for years. Then at some point I replaced all my green followers with Magpul followers. No reason for it, I just wanted Magpul gear. Then I shot them for many more years. It's very safe to say I have mags from each brand with well over 2000rds though them. I've experienced zero malfunctions in the last 14ish years of use. Note: All my shooting is done on a 2D range with no one shooting back.
Anything except USA mags. Used mil-spec (Colt, Adventure Line, O.K., Universal, etc.) from the Viet Nam era work forever. I have dozens in various condition, some with NO finish left, and they still work as well now as they did when they were issued.
